Dhysores
Dhysores is a genus of beetles in the family Carabidae.[1][2] It is confined to Africa.[1][3]

Species
    
There are seven species:[1]
- Dhysores basilewskyi (Brinck, 1965)
 - Dhysores biimpressus R.T. & J.R. Bell, 1985
 - Dhysores liber R.T. & J.R. Bell, 1979
 - Dhysores pan R.T. & J.R. Bell, 1979
 - Dhysores quadriimpressus (Grouvelle, 1910)
 - Dhysores rhodesianus (Brinck, 1965)
 - Dhysores thoreyi (Grouvelle, 1903)
